Primate Ayodele has predicted a massive hunger revolt against the Tinubu Government.

 

NewsOnline Nigeria reports that Primate Elijah Ayodele, the Leader of INRI Evangelical Spiritual Church, revealed on Friday that there will be more hardship in 2025.

 

Primate Ayodele said there would be an economic blackout, which would cause citizens to revolt against the Nigerian government.

 

In a statement signed by his media aide, Osho Oluwatosin, Primate Ayodele made it known that the Nigerian government had failed to perform its duties by working towards bringing an end to the current hardship faced by Nigerian citizens.

Primate Ayodele noted that Nigerians are suffering but it will bite harder next year unless the government does what is expected of it.

 

He said refineries will not solve Nigeria’s problems because it will be frustrated.

‘’As it is now, we will soon buy rice for N150,000 and beans for more than N200,000. The government hasn’t done what they are supposed to do to bring the price of food commodities down.

 

“People are suffering and haven’t enjoyed this government. Instead it’s still more suffering and agony.

‘’The hardship is coming up and will bite Nigeria hard next year. The government has refused to solve the country’s problems and that’s why the Nigerian economy will fail.

 

“Refinery will not create anything and foreign exchange will not improve, it will still increase except something is done but I don’t see this government doing anything.’’

 

Primate Ayodele noted that economic hardship will be three times harder next year unless the government does the needful.

 

He added: ‘’The price of every commodity, kerosene, gas, diesel, etc will continue to be expensive because there is so much rot in the country.

 

“The government ought to take out some people from this administration, but it’s surprising that the president is comfortable despite the gross irresponsibility in the country.

 

‘’Economic hardship will be times three of what we are experiencing now next year; the government must be careful so that the citizens will not revolt. There will be a kind of economic blackout.’’
